I’ve loved this stamp set / die combo since it came out, but I haven’t used it yet (fairly typical for me – I think I get intimidated by the wealth of awesome cards that are made with sets that I love). I figured this was a perfect opportunity to pull the products out!
The card base is rustic cream cardstock. I used the border die to cut off a bit from the card base front. Then I embossed a kraft panel (card front size) and adhered it to the inside of the card. I did a full front size because I didn’t want a seam to show inside.

Stamps: Botanical Blooms, Endless Birthday Wishes (Stampin’Up – SU);
Ink: Mossy Meadow (SU);
Paper: Rustic Cream, Kraft (Papertrey Ink); Mossy Meadow, Tangelo Twist, Hello Honey (SU);
Other: Botanical Builder die, Woodgrain embossing (SU);
